A retail pharmacist opportunity is available within a well-established network operating multiple pharmacy locations with additional expansions planned. This contract position offers the chance to join a dedicated float team managing medium to high volume prescriptions across several sites, supported by experienced pharmacy technicians and professional management.

Location:

  • Based primarily in and around Sanger, CA, with daily commutes up to 30-40 minutes to surrounding communities such as Fresno, Parlier, Reedley, Selma, Kerman, Orange Cove, and Madera.
  • Some sites offer mileage reimbursement for travel to Huron, Earlimart, and Mendota.

Schedule:

  • Monday through Friday with an excellent, consistent schedule.
  • 20+ shifts per month, averaging nearly full-time hours.
  • Frequency entails covering one of the 12 pharmacies 3-4 times per week.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age retail pharmacy operations with medium to high prescription volumes.
  • Provide expert drug dispensing, counseling, and patient care in accordance with state and federal laws.
  • Collaborate with pharmacy technicians and healthcare professionals to ensure optimal service.
  • Utilize Rx30 pharmacy software efficiently.

Desired Qualifications:

  • Minimum of six months retail pharmacy experience.
  • Familiarity with managing a bustling pharmacy environment.
  • Spanish language skills are strongly preferred but not mandatory due to Spanish-speaking technician support.
  • Valid California pharmacist license.
  • Ability to commute to multiple locations within a reasonable travel radius.

Perks:

  • Join a float team that offers diverse work environments and professional growth.
  • Supportive, well-managed pharmacy sites backed by strong corporate resources.
  • Mileage reimbursement provided for select farther locations.
